A field of 32 teams qualified for this World Cup, which was the first to be held in Asiajapan world cup 2002, the first to be held outside of the Americas or Europe, as well as the first to be jointly-hosted by more than one nation.

No sporting organisation had ever attempted to host an event the size or scale of the World Cup across two nations, never mind in a pair of countries that had used tactics fair and foul to disparage the other in an attempt to claim the rights to themselves. FIFA were stepping into new territory. We hope that this can be a milestone to overcoming past problems and have a better relationship in the future. It was FIFA executive committee member Chung, a scion of the influential family that owns the Hyundai conglomerate, who had done much to drive a wedge between the two countries throughout a drawn-out and poisonous bidding campaign. The shrewd US-educated year-old had brought all his political guile and ruthlessness to bear on the campaign to overhaul early favourites Japan and secure his nation a share of the World Cup many in South Korea believed was their right. By contrast, the Japanese were the cash-rich new kids on the football block. Velappan, the de facto leader of Asian football for much of the previous two decades, had been at the vanguard of those pushing for co-hosting and his concerns were well founded.

It was the first time the FIFA World Cup took place on the continent -- co-hosted by Japan and South Korea -- and subsequently led to both advancing out of the group stage for the maiden achievement of two Asian teams reaching the knockout round. On Sunday, the end of an era officially drew closer with Samurai Blue legend Shinji Ono playing his final match at the age of While Japan internationals are now commonplace in Europe, and featuring in starring roles no less, it was that pioneering group from both the and World Cups that first led to a wave of players earning big moves to the continent. With Ono's retirement, only one player remains active from the Japan team that became the first to reach the knockout round of the World Cup. But who is it? And whatever happened to the rest of those Samurai Blue heroes that captured the imagination in the summer of ? It would be remiss not to begin with the man who just called time on his career -- poetically at the age of 44, which is also the number he has been wearing for Consadole Sapporo. While his career has gradually come to a close back in Japan over the past decade, Ono -- at his peak -- was a mercurial playmaker whose undeniable talent earned him a move to Eredivisie giants Feyenoord at the age of Injuries ultimately were not kind to Ono but he did lift the now-defunct UEFA Cup with Feyenoord in , while also having a brilliant stint in Australia's A-League with Western Sydney Wanderers even when he was in the twilight of his career. Widely regarded as Japan's greatest player ever, Hidetoshi Nakata 's move to Europe actually arrived right after the World Cup when he signed for Perugia in Serie A. Nakata took Italian football by storm with ten league goals from midfield in his debut season but the biggest moment of his career would come after he joined Roma.

A field of 32 teams qualified for this World Cup, which was the first to be held in Asia , the first to be held outside of the Americas or Europe, as well as the first to be jointly-hosted by more than one nation. China , Ecuador , Senegal , and Slovenia made their World Cup debuts, with Senegal being the only debutant to qualify the group stages and made it to the quarterfinals. The tournament had several upsets and surprise results, which included the defending champions France being eliminated in the group stage after earning a single point without scoring a goal and second favourites Argentina also being eliminated in the group stage. However, the most potent team at the tournament, Brazil , prevailed, winning the final against Germany 2—0, making them the first and only country to have won the World Cup five times. The World Cup was also the last one to use the golden goal rule and the last one to use the same ball for all matches. Starting in and continuing to the present, a ball with the same technical specifications but different colors has been used in the final. Initially, South Korea, Japan and Mexico presented three rival bids. South Korea's entry into the race was seen by some as a response to the bid of political and sporting rival Japan.
